Pair of Coalbrookdale Serpent and Grape Pattern Iron Garden Benches
By Coalbrookdale Foundry
Located in Rio Vista, CA
Spectacular pair of English cast iron garden benches having a "serpent and grape" pattern by Coalbrookdale Foundry. The benches have a rare iron slatted seat and backrest. The end supports feature a snake curled around the legs eating a grape cluster. The gracefully curved arms end with dogs head terminals. The patinated iron has a painted finish. Excellent joinery and craftsmanship from a historic foundry. Also known as "dog and serpent...

David Horan Paper daybed for Béton Brut, UK, 2022
By David Horan
Located in London, GB
David Horan (born in Dublin, 1982) is a multidisciplinary designer and manufacturer based in London. With a Master of Arts in Design Products from the Royal College of Art 2013, he cut his cloth with London-designers Faye Toogood and Michael Anastassiades, before opening his own studio in 2021. This handmade daybed is part of the inaugural furniture and lighting collection by Horan entitled Paper. The collection ‘Paper’, designed exclusively with Béton Brut gallery, sees Horan as a modern decoupeur, applying his material to an original series of works. The magic of paper is grounded in forms as precise as they are architectonic. Evoking Deco and Classical, the geometries contain harmony in ratio. ‘Paper’ is as much an experiment in de-composition as re-composition, the Dragon Skin daybed, left raw, is made from vintage handmade paper...
